Summary
TI: Background-In the subject vehicles the front catalytic converter internal components may become deteriorated and begin to rattle. If continually operated in this condition, the deteriorated components could become dislodged and restrict the exhaust flow. If this occurs, the vehicle may illuminate a check engine light, and, depending on the level of exhaust restriction, the vehicle may experience a reduction in power. Toyota
has developed a new exhaust pipe with catalytic converters to prevent this condition from occurring.

B. INSTALL NEW ENGINE ROOM MAIN HARNESS
1. INSTALL ENGINE ROOM MAIN HARNESS INTO THE VEHICLE
CABIN
a) Insert the hood lock cable into the harness grommet.
b) Insert the engine room main harness from the engine room into
the vehicle cabin as shown.
28
c) Connect the 5 female connectors and engage the clamps located in the foot pedal area as shown.
d) Connect the 5 female connectors and 2 male connectors that are located at the back of the connector holder No.
5.
29
e) Fasten the connector holder No. 5 with the bolt.
Torque Spec: 8.0Nm (82 kgf-cm, 71 in-lbf)
f)
Connect the 5 connectors to the connector holder No. 5.
30
g) Engage the clamp to the connector holder No. 5.
2. REINSTALL DRIVER’S SIDE JUNCTION BLOCK
a) Install the junction block with the 2 nuts.
Torque Spec: 8.0Nm (82 kgf-cm, 71 in-lbf)
b) Install the bracket with the 2 bolts.
Torque Spec: 8.0Nm (82 kgf-cm, 71 in-lbf)

A. ENGINE WIRE HARNESS REMOVAL
1. DISCONNECT THE BATTERY
2. REMOVE AIR CLEANER CAP
a) Disconnect the mass air flow meter connector.
b) Disconnect the wire harness clamp.
c) Loosen the hose clamp bolt, then disconnect the air cleaner
hose No. 1.
d) Disconnect the 2 air cleaner lid clamps.
e) Remove the air cleaner cap together with the air cleaner hose
No. 1.
3. REMOVE INTAKE AIR CONNECTOR
a)
b)
c)
d)
e)
f)
Disconnect the pressure sensor connector.
Disengage the wire harness clamp.
Disconnect the vacuum hoses.
Disconnect the No. 2 ventilation hose.
Loosen the hose clamp bolt.
Remove the 3 bolts and the air connector.

XI. APPENDIX
A. CAMPAIGN DESIGNATION DECODER
F
0
Year Campaign is Launched Repair Phase
8 = 2008
9 = 2009
A = 2010
B = 2011
C = 2012
D = 2013
E = 2014
F = 2015
Etc...
0 = Remedy
1 = Interim (Remedy
not yet available) “1”
will change to “0” when
the Remedy is
available
J
Current Campaign Letter
for this year
1st Campaign = A
2nd Campaign = B
3rd Campaign = C
4th Campaign = D
5th Campaign = E
6th Campaign = F
7th Campaign = G
8th Campaign = H
9th Campaign = I
Etc...
Examples:
A0D = Launched in 2010, Remedy Phase, 4th Campaign Launched in 2010
B1E = Launched in 2011, Interim Phase, 5rd Campaign Launched in 2011
C1C = Launched in 2012, Interim Phase, 3rd Campaign Launched in 2012
